Default Outlook 2003 tzmove udate utility

I'm wondering whether the Outlook timezone data update tool needs to be run. I assume not but I want to be sure.

From http://wiki.zimbra.com/index.php?tit...r_2007_and_ZCS

Quote:
Zimbra Connector for Outlook users
zmfixtz changes will be synced to Outlook. Users should still install the patch from KB article 931836.

We do not recommend that users run the Outlook Time Zone Data Update Tool. zmfixtz will perform the same set of changes and will enable the changes to be propagated to all clients. There is no harm in running the Outlook Time Zone Data Update Tool if a user chooses to do so.

The point of installing the OS time zone patch for these users is that newly created appointments will be correct. Newly created appointments will be incorrect until the OS time zone patch is applied. Note that zmfixtz will fix these appointments, but as long as the user does not have the OS time zone patch the appointment will not display correctly.
